So what type of cover do I need?

Like car insurance, standard cover comes in three standard types. Third Party only, Third Party to include Fire and Theft and Comprehensive. We understand that in most cases it is critical that you keep your Van on the road, so there are optional covers available which help you do this.

3rd party van insurance quotes UK

Third Party Insurance

The most basic cover, and the minimum required by law is Third Party Only Insurance, this covers others in the event of an accident.
3rd party fire and theft van insurance quotes UK

Third Party Fire and Theft Insurance

Third Party Only Insurance can be extended to cover Fire and Theft. This is known as Third Party Fire and Theft Insurance.
comprehensive van insurance quote comparisons UK

Comprehensive Insurance

The most extensive level of cover is known as Comprehensive, this will cover you for most types of accidental damage as well as Third Party and Fire and Theft. Some of these policies do have exclusions though. We recommend the level of cover and exclusions are checked before purchase.

I have a Van. What Insurance do I need?

Social, Domestic and Pleasure

The answer depends on what you’re going to use your van for. If you have a van for personal reasons, perhaps because of a hobby such as carrying your fishing tackle, then you will need Insurance in a similar manner to Car Insurance. This cover is known as personal or private van insurance, and the type of cover required will be ‘Social, Domestic and Pleasure’, often abbreviated to ‘SD&P’. It is important to point out that this cover is for your own personal use only and absolutely excludes any use in connection with your occupation, even commuting to and from a place of work. We are able to offer competitive quotes for this type of insurance.

 

Commercial Van Insurance

If your Van is going to be used in connection with any part of a business, including travelling to and from a business, you must have Commercial Van Insurance, there are a range of options available reflecting the large number of commercial uses ranging from carriage of own and other goods to Minibus Insurance. It is important that you choose the correct cover that reflects how you use your Van. If you use your van for a different class of use than your policy allows, your policy will be invalid and could leave you liable for not having Insurance.

Commercial Van Insurance can be tailored to the specific needs of your commercial requirements. This can include things like cover for tools and/or other contents. We advise that you use the services of an experienced Broker such as ourselves to get the best advice!

How much will my Insurance cost?

Like car insurance, your age, your driving record and where you live are important, but for Commercial Van Insurance your commercial use is critically important too. You need to make sure your Insurer fully understands the nature of your commercial activities.

1

Your Age

Drivers under 20 are statistically 33% more likely to be involved in an accident. Because of this, younger van drivers usually face higher premiums. On the other hand, older drivers with a solid no-claims history may benefit from lower quotes through a no-claims bonus.

2

Your Occupation

If your job keeps you on the road for long hours, it can push up your insurance costs. Higher annual mileage and driving during peak traffic times increase the likelihood of being involved in an accident.

3

Your Location

Where you live has a direct impact on your premium. Accident rates, congestion levels, and local crime all affect risk. Parking on a driveway or in a garage can reduce this, helping protect your van from theft and accidental damage.

4

Driving Record

Penalty points, fines, or a history of risky driving make insurers view you as higher risk. Research shows three penalty points can raise premiums by around 5%, while six points could increase costs by up to 25%.

5

Claims History

If you’ve made claims in the past, insurers may assume you’re more likely to make them again. Taking an advanced driving course could help counter this perception and may even unlock discounts with some providers.

6

Medical History

Certain medical conditions can affect your ability to drive safely, which insurers will factor into your policy cost. Serious conditions must be reported to the DVLA, but even minor issues such as side effects from medication or seasonal hay fever can influence driving ability.

7

No Claims Discount

More than three million UK drivers could be saving money through no-claims discounts. In fact, building a strong no-claims history can reduce your premiums by as much as 60–70%.

8

Provider & Policy Choice

Each insurer assesses risk differently. Some specialise in certain drivers or policies, like black box insurance, and may offer cheaper rates. That’s why comparing multiple providers before buying is key to finding the best deal.
